/* CSS Document */

UL.hr {  padding: 0px;   margin:0;}
UL.hr li { display: inline; margin-left: 5;  background:   url(/img/arrow.gif) no-repeat; background-position: left;  padding-left:10;  color: FFFFFF; font: normal 10px  Arial;}
UL.hr a {color: FFFFFF;}
UL.menu li {  background:  url(/img/arrow_grey.gif) no-repeat; background-position: left;  padding-left:15; margin-bottom:15;  margin-left:-10; font: bold 12px  Arial;  list-style-type: none; color:697277;}
UL.menu li  a {  font: normal 12px  Arial;}


td {font: normal 10pt  Arial;color: 444F55;}
td.selected_l{background:url(/img/s_l_down.gif) no-repeat;  background-position: bottom; }
td.selected_r{background:url(/img/s_r_down.gif) no-repeat;  background-position: bottom;}
td.pagetitle{font: bold 12pt Arial; color: 1790B9; }
a{ color: 1790B9;}


#news_date{margin-bottom:10; background:url( /img/nd_bg.gif) no-repeat 0 0; height:17px;  font: 8pt Arial;  color: FFFFFF; padding: 2 0 0 4;}
#mailinput{margin-left:18px; margin-top:10px;}
#mailok{margin-left:2px; margin-top:11px; }
#mailradio{margin-left:14px;}
#footerbg{background:   url(/img/footer_left.gif) no-repeat 0 0; height:73px; float: left; width: 500px; margin-right: 20px; }
#counter { float: left; width: 100px; padding-top: 15px; }
#footer{font: bold 11px  Arial;color: FFFFFF; padding-top:15px; padding-left:30px;}
#copy{font: normal 11px  Arial;color: EB9900; padding-left:30px;}
#headmenu{background:   url(/img/menu_bg.jpg) no-repeat 0 0; height:184px; }
#nav{ font: normal 8pt Arial; color:FFFFFF; margin-left:32;}
.nav2{margin:20 0 20 0;}
.dbl-nav{margin:0 0 0 25;}

.print  a {font: normal 7pt  Arial;color: 1790B9; text-decoration: none;}
.nav1{margin:10 0 0 10;}
.nav1-off{margin:5 0 15 15;}
.nav1-on{margin:-3 0 9 0;}
.head_menu_selected a{font: bold 11px Arial; text-decoration:none; color:FFFFFF;}
.radiotext{font: normal 7pt; color: FFFFFF;}
.ok {margin-top:2px; margin-left:2px;}
.inputtext{
border-bottom: D4D2C6 solid 1px;
border-right: D4D2C6 solid 1px;
border-top: 404040 solid 1px;
border-left: 404040 solid 1px;
width:180px; height:16px;
padding: 0 0 0 5;
font: normal 8pt Arial;
color 444F55;
}
h1,h2,h4,h5,h6 {color:1790B9;}
h1{font: bold 14pt Arial; padding:0 0 0 0; margin:0 0 0 0;}
h2{font: bold 12pt Arial;}
h3{font: bold 10pt Arial; color:444F55;}
th h2{text-align:left;}

.forminput {
width:300px;
padding: 0 0 0 5;
font: normal 8pt Arial;
color 444F55;}
.formsubmit {
width:100px; height: 20px;
 border: solid  0px #FFF; 
 color:FFF; 
 background-color:1790B9; 
 font: bold 11px arial;
 cursor: hand;
 
 }

.download { padding: 0 0 5px 30px; background: url(/img/i-download.gif) no-repeat 0 2px; margin-top: 4px; }

DIV.prov-group { margin-bottom: 50px; }
DIV.prov { margin-bottom: 20px; clear:left;}
DIV.prov-logo { float:left; width: 90px; height: 40px; }
DIV.prov-title { font-weight: bold; }
DIV.prov-title SPAN { font-weight: normal; color: #999999; }
DIv.prov-descr { position: relative; width: 100%;}
